We're looking for a Lead Software Engineer who's as comfortable talking about how a business makes money as they are designing a distributed system. This is a hands-on technical leadership role: you'll own initiatives end-to-end, partner closely with product, and help set the technical direction for a team that moves fast and operates with high autonomy.
You'll report to our VP of Engineering and work in a flat structure where ICs lead projects, not just contribute to them. We run parallel initiatives at any given time in small, two-person tribe structures. We expect the people who join us to be the kind who step up, make decisions, and take accountability for outcomes, technical and otherwise.
What you'll do
Own complex technical initiatives from conception to delivery, including architecture decisions, implementation, and cross-functional coordination with product and business stakeholders.
Lead cross-functional efforts (tiger teams and initiative-based squads) and serve as the technical point of accountability for the initiatives you're running.
Design and implement scalable microservices solutions, with particular attention to reliability, performance, and maintainability in a high-volume financial transactions environment.
Partner with the product to understand the business context and translate it into technical decisions. This means understanding why something matters to the business, not just what needs to be built.
Raise the technical bar across the team through code review, architecture feedback, and knowledge sharing with less senior engineers.
Leverage AI tooling as a core part of how you work. We're an AI-forward team and expect you to have a sophisticated, evolved setup, not just basic usage.
What you'll bring
8+ years of software engineering experience, ideally including time at a fintech, high-growth startup, or company operating at scale.
Proficiency in Golang, Rust or openness to work with it.
Experience designing and evolving scalable architectures — microservices, distributed systems, or monoliths — with a clear point of view on the tradeoffs of each.
Hands-on experience with Kubernetes, PostgreSQL, and cloud platforms (we're on AWS).
Demonstrated ability to lead a project from soup to nuts. This means technical execution, stakeholder communication, and delivery accountability.
Business acumen: you understand how software products make money, you care about it, and it informs how you make technical decisions.
English communication skills sufficient to collaborate effectively with our teams in the US, Canada, and Brazil (our engineering team is based in Brazil!).
Experience in fintech or payments is a strong plus, but the more important signal is whether you've worked somewhere that expected you to understand the full picture.
Nice-to-haves
Background as an Engineering Manager, Staff Engineer, Lead Engineer or Tech Lead with a desire to return to hands-on technical work.
Experience at companies serving US-based markets. Familiarity with the communication norms and business context that come with that.
Comfort with event-driven architectures (RabbitMQ or similar).
A sophisticated AI-assisted workflow: multiple models, custom agents, specialized contexts, integrated into planning and implementation, not just Copilot autocomplete.
Track record of mentoring engineers and raising team output, not just individual output.
